You might believe that a 27-year-old picking up Jiu-Jitsu might never achieve any real level of success. Going against these pre-defined notions makes Sankalita Chakraborty&#8217;s swift rise to winning the Women&#8217;s Intermediate -55kg at the ADCC India Nationals seem all the more amazing.<\/span><\/p>\n<p class=\"p3\"><span class=\"s2\">\u201c<\/span><span class=\"s1\">I only got into sports or martial\u00a0arts in 2017. I started with practising Kickboxing and Muay Thai and then moved into Jiu-Jitsu in June 2018. Her husband, Debayan shares her passion and has trained himself in different forms of martial arts since childhood. Like most of the Indian kids of the 90s, his martial arts journey began with karate but he soon got introduced to a rare form of Kung fu called the Southern Praying Mantis by his brother-in-law.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>He is extremely passionate and very, very committed to practising this art. He has been practising this form for twenty years now and has taught students for thirteen years.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;He is the one who introduced Jiu-Jitsu to me and our lives have changed since then,&#8221;\u00a0said Sankalita. &#8220;We don&#8217;t have a trainer training us in Jiu-Jitsu. We are a group of self-driven practitioners with varying degrees of experience and expertise who meets every weekend on our terrace to learn from and inspire each other.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-medium wp-image-2711 alignright\" src=\"https:\/\/globalindianstories.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/03\/ADCC2-shrunk-300x181.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"300\" height=\"181\" srcset=\"https:\/\/globalindianstories.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/03\/ADCC2-shrunk-300x181.jpg 300w, https:\/\/globalindianstories.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/03\/ADCC2-shrunk-768x463.jpg 768w, https:\/\/globalindianstories.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/03\/ADCC2-shrunk-697x420.jpg 697w, https:\/\/globalindianstories.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/03\/ADCC2-shrunk-640x386.jpg 640w, https:\/\/globalindianstories.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/03\/ADCC2-shrunk.jpg 800w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px\" \/>&#8220;We are called Jiu-Jitsu Ronins. The experience of practising together has been very rewarding. Debayan is a Jiu-Jitsu nerd and dedicates time everyday before and after work to learn something new about the art everyday which he shares with me. Learning something together and getting better at it is gratifying. He is my team mate and coach. Practising together has also taught us to appreciate each other more.
